Chasing climate goals in a sanctions-targeted country

Getty Images Sanctions against Zimbabwe over human rights violations is impacting its ability to secure capital for certain projects. Zimbabwe has managed to mobilise funding for climate-smart agriculture but struggles to attract investment for renewable energy. Export ban means Chinese firms will have to build plants in Zimbabwe to process lithium

Chinese companies that have made multimillion-dollar acquisitions in Zimbabwe will have to build lithium processing plants after the southern African nation banned the export of the metal in its raw form.
